Where do you park for a cruise out of Fort Lauderdale?
- ParkingLots. Parking Lot A has 770spaces and is located near Cruise Terminals 19 and 26. The entrance is at 2000 Eller Drive.
- Parking Lot Bhas 404spacesand is located between Cruise Terminals 18 and 19. The entrance is located offSE 19th Ave.
- Parking Lot Chas600 spacesadjacent to Cruise Terminal 18.
How early can you board Princess cruise ship?
Boarding begins around 10:30 or 11am. Believe your cruise probably sails at 3pm. The cruise line is required to submit a passenger manifest to the authorities 60 minutes before they sail. You must be checked in before that time. It is recommended that you arrive no later than 90 minutes before sailing. Many passengers arrive at the pier early, maybe 9:30 or so and wait.

- Azamara Onward makes her maiden call on October 21, 2023, after a multi-million-dollar makeover.
- Celebrity Ascent will be named on December 3, 2023, to begin her inaugural Caribbean season. She is the fourth and largest ship in Celebrity’s Edge class.
- Crystal Serenity from newly rebranded luxury line Cystal, is anticipated to begin homeporting at Port Everglades in December 2023.
- Disney Dream will homeport starting November 20, 2023. Port Everglades will be one of only two Disney Cruise Line homeports in the world.
- Silver Nova this environmentally- friendly luxury ship will make her maiden call on January 4,2024, using liquefied natural gas (LNG) as its main fuel.
- Sun Princess is scheduled to debut in October 2024 as Princess Cruises’ largest and first LNG-powered ship.
- Symphony of the Seas will shift to Port Everglades after returning from Europe in November 2023.

How much is parking for the Princess Cruises in Fort Lauderdale?
Parking Fees$4 for 0 – 1 hour.$8 for up to 5 hours, and fees for additional hours vary up to the daily maximum based on vehicle type.$20 daily maximum.$25 daily maximum for oversized vehicles (those that exceed the standard width and/or height of a parking space).
